How to Reset the Maintenance Reminder on the Volkswagen Lamando?

The steps to reset the maintenance reminder on the Volkswagen Lamando are: 1. Press and hold the button on the right side of the instrument panel, turn on the ignition without starting the engine; 2. When "SERVICE" is displayed, press and hold the button on the left side of the instrument panel until the next maintenance mileage is shown to complete the reset. The Volkswagen Lamando has the following dimensions: length 4615 mm, width 1826 mm, height 1425 mm, with a wheelbase of 2656 mm and a fuel tank capacity of 51 liters. The Volkswagen Lamando is equipped with a 1.4T tur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um power of 96 kW at 5000 rpm and a maximum torque of 225 Nm between 1400 and 3500 rpm.

What do the E and S gears mean on the Baojun 510?

Baojun 510's E gear stands for Economy mode, while the S gear represents Sport mode. The Economy mode focuses on fuel efficiency and smooth driving, whereas the Sport mode emphasizes power performance. The Baojun 510 has the following dimensions: length 4220mm, width 1740mm, height 1615mm, with a wheelbase of 2550mm. It features a fuel tank capacity of 45 liters and a trunk space ranging from 318 to 1210 liters. The Baojun 510 is equipped with a 1.5L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um power of 73 kW and a maximum torque of 135 Nm. It is paired with a 6-speed manual transmission. The front suspension utilizes a MacPherson strut independent suspension, and the rear suspension employs a torsion beam non-independent suspension.

How long after applying car window film can you wash the car?

You can wash the car 2 to 3 weeks after applying the window film. The precautions after applying the film are: 1. Do not open the windows for 5 to 7 days; 2. Avoid wiping the film surface with cloths containing chemical solvents; 3. Do not place heavy objects on the heat-insulating film surface to prevent hard objects from damaging the film. The functions of car window film are: 1. Blocking a large amount of heat generated by infrared rays; 2. Blocking some ultraviolet rays to prevent skin damage and reduce the aging of car interiors; 3. Enhancing the strength of the glass to prevent injuries to passengers caused by accidental glass breakage. Car window film is a thin film applied to the front and rear windshields, side windows, and sunroof of a vehicle. This thin film is called solar film or heat-insulating film.

How to Use the M+ and M- in an Automatic Transmission?

The method for using the M+ and M- in an automatic transmission is as follows: 1. When driving continuously downhill, adjust the gear to 2nd or 3rd using M+ or M- to utilize the engine's braking effect for vehicle deceleration; 2. Use M- to downshift and provide sufficient torque. When encountering a steep slope, downshift to 1st or 2nd gear for more power during uphill driving; 3. Adjust the gear to 2nd using M+ or M- to reduce wheel slippage. The correct steps for starting an automatic transmission vehicle are: 1. Turn the ignition key to the second position (power mode); 2. Press the foot brake and shift the gear from P to N; 3. Release the foot brake and turn the ignition key to the ignition position; 4. Press the foot brake, release the handbrake, and shift the gear from N to D; 5. Depending on road conditions, smoothly press the accelerator pedal.
